The Ministry of Justice has launched a digital platform related to "Absence Proceedings," concerning 656 individuals who have cases pending in the Court of Appeals. The initiative aims to update the justice system and strengthen digital transformation within the judicial administration. The platform urges these individuals to quickly present themselves at the nearest judicial or security authority to resolve their legal status. It also allows users to access details of their legal cases, including the name of the court, case number, the accused's name and parents, identification card number, residence address, and the nature of the charges against them.
